General Dentists H1B Salary in WARNER ROBINS, GA
General Dentists H1B Overview in WARNER ROBINS
General Dentists positions in WARNER ROBINS, GA have attracted 2 H1B labor condition applications from 2 employers. The average salary offered on these H1B applications is $169,000, with salaries ranging from $169,000 to $169,000.
The leading H1B sponsor for General Dentists in WARNER ROBINS is LAURA C. KOCH, DMD, PC. View the H1B visa guide for details on sponsorship eligibility and the approval process.
Nationally, General Dentists positions have 9,817 total H1B filings with an average salary of $138,949. See the full General Dentists H1B national overview for more details, or explore General Dentists H1B data in Georgia.
